Veri Yapısında Ağaç ve Grafik Arasındaki Fark

Veri Yapısında Ağaç ve Grafik
 

Ağaçlar ve grafik karmaşık bilgisayar problemlerini çözmek için kullanılan doğrusal olmayan veri yapıları olduğundan, veri yapısında ağaç ve grafik arasındaki farkı bilmek faydalıdır. Her iki veri yapısı da veri öğelerini matematiksel formda temsil eder. Makalenin temel amacı, doğrusal olmayan veri yapılarının önemini vurgulamaktır. Ayrıca bu iki veri yapısı arasındaki temel farkı da içerir..

Veri Yapısında Bir Ağaç Nedir?

Ağaç, tüm veri öğelerinin sıralı bir sırada düzenlendiği doğrusal olmayan bir veri yapısıdır. Ağaç, sınırlı bir veri öğesi kümesi tanımlar. Her veri öğesi düğüm olarak adlandırılır. Kök düğüm olarak da adlandırılan özel bir üst düğüm var. Diğer tüm düğümler alt düğüm veya alt alt düğümlerdir. Ağacın temel amacı, farklı veri öğeleri arasındaki hiyerarşik ilişkiyi göstermektir. Normal ağaç üst yönde büyür, ancak veri yapısı ağacı aşağı yönde büyür. Ağaca bağlanan tüm alt düğümler çeşitli seviyelere ayrılır. İkili ağaç, doğrusal olmayan veri yapısının en yaygın örneğidir. İkili ağacın maksimum derecesi ikidir. Her üst düğüme maksimum iki düğümün bağlanabileceği anlamına gelir.

Veri Yapısında Grafik Nedir?

Grafik, çeşitli bilgisayar sorunlarını çözmek için kullanılan, doğrusal olmayan popüler bir veri yapısıdır. Çeşitli oyunlar ve bulmacalar tasarlamak için kullanılırlar. Grafikler birçok kategoriye ayrılabilir. Bunlar:

Yönlendirilmiş grafik: Yönlendirilen grafikte, her kenar sıralı çift köşe ile tanımlanır.

Yönlendirilmemiş Grafik: Yönlendirilmemiş grafikte, her kenar sırasız çift köşe ile tanımlanır

Bağlı grafik: Bağlı yolda, her tepe noktasından diğer tepe noktasına giden bir yol vardır..

Bağlantısız Grafik: Bağlı olmayan grafikte, herhangi bir tepe noktasından başka bir tepe noktasına giden yol yok.

Ağırlıklı Grafik: Ağırlıklı grafikte kenara biraz ağırlık eklenir.

Basit Grafik veya Çoklu Grafik

Veri Yapısında Ağaç ve Grafik Arasındaki Benzerlikler

• Ağaçlar ve grafiklerin her ikisi de karmaşık bilgisayar sorunlarını çözmek için kullanılan doğrusal olmayan veri yapısıdır.

• Her iki veri yapısı da bir üst düğüm ve birden çok alt düğüm kullanır.

Veri Yapısında Ağaç ve Grafik Arasındaki Fark Nedir??

• Ağaç özel bir grafik durumu olarak kabul edilir. Ayrıca minimal bağlı bir grafik olarak da adlandırılır.

• Her ağaç bir grafik olarak kabul edilebilir, ancak her grafik bir ağaç olarak kabul edilemez.

• Kendinden döngüler ve devreler, grafiklerde olduğu gibi ağaçta mevcut değildir.

• Ağaç tasarlamak için bir üst düğüme ve çeşitli alt düğümlere ihtiyacınız vardır. Bir grafik tasarlamak için köşelere ve kenarlara ihtiyacınız vardır. Kenar bir çift köşe.

Yukarıdaki tartışma, ağaç ve grafiğin, çeşitli karmaşık sorunları çözmek için kullanılan en popüler veri yapıları olduğu sonucuna varmaktadır. Grafikler, bilgisayar tasarımı, fiziksel yapılar ve mühendislik biliminde kullanılan daha popüler bir veri yapısıdır. Bulmacaların çoğu grafik veri yapısı yardımıyla tasarlanmıştır. En kısa mesafe problemi en sık kullanılan veri yapısıdır. Bu problemde, iki köşe arasındaki en kısa mesafeyi hesaplamalıyız.

Daha fazla okuma:

  1. Grafik ve Ağaç Arasındaki Fark